Abstract.  The discovery of organic- and molecule-based magnets has

led to design and synthesis of several families with

magnetic ordering temperatures as high as

$\sim$125$^{\circ}$C.  Examples of soft  and hard magnets

with coercivities as high as 27 kOe have also been

reported.  Examples from our laboratory of organic-based

magnets using the tetracyanoethylene  radical anion,

[TCNE]$^{\bullet -}$, are discussed.  In addition, several

molecule-based magnets based on Prussian Blue structured materials

as well as dicyanamide are discussed.
